In this book, the design of InGaN LDs structures including multi quantum wells (MQWs) active region device are described and investigated by integrated system engineering technology computer aided design (ISE TCAD) device simulator. The parameters of the LDs structures are varied and optimized for high performance. This optimization study involves aspects such as thickness of active region, doping, thickness of stopper layer region, thickness of quantum wells and quantum barriers, number of quantum wells and several approaches to improve and achieve high efficiency, low threshold current and high output power of InGaN LDs. The basic LDs structures treated here are FabryPerot type InGaN double heterostructure (DH), separate confinement heterostructure (SCH) and multi quantum wells (MQWs).High performance LD has been obtained by using multi quantum wells incorporated with the optimized parameters. The lowest threshold current, higher external quantum efficiency and characteristic temperature are obtained when the number of InGaN well layers is two, at our laser emission wavelength of 415 nm, which is related to the problem of inhomogeneous carrier. Enterococc faecalis considered to be the mostresistant bacteria of the root canal, in the presentstudy we used two types of root canal disinfectant toshow their effect on this type of bacteria, the firstis the diode laser and the second NaOCl solution withspecial concentrations and times. the study conductedon human decoronated extracted teeth, adjusted with13mm root length, filled with a suspension of E.faecalis, Samples were divided into 14 groups eachgroup consisted of 10 prepared roots, sixty sampleswere irrigated with NaOCl solution at differentconcentrations (0.5, 2.5 and 5.25) at twoselected times (2 minutes and 5 minutes) for eachconcentration.Sixty samples were irradiated at different powers (2W, 2.5W and 3W); each power at thetotal irradiation time 30 and 60 seconds. Whencomparison was made between NaOCl irrigant and diodelaser in a combination among differentconcentrations, powers and times the result showedthat 5.25 NaOCl at both 2 minutes and 5 minutes hadthe highest antimicrobial effect with no significantdifferences from 3W laser / 10 sec (6 cycles) butsignificantly different from 3W / 5 sec (6 cycles). ThinkGeek, I'm a techie. How does it really work? The Laser Stars Projector utilizes a state of the art Diode Pumped, Solid State (DPSS) green laser combined with custom developed multiphase diffractive holographic optics, super luminous diodes and precision motors to produce the laser stars effect. The coherent light produced by the DPSS laser passes through a passive diffractive holographic optical element, which in turn passes through a circular periodicity electromechanical wheel, which is driven by a precision motor to create the soothing motion of the star field. What Kinds of Laser Hair Removal Equipment are Available?

Now that you have made the decision to undergo laser hair removal therapy, you are probably curious as to the types of laser hair removal equipment. The good news is that the technology has come so far over the multiple decades of its existence that there are now many options for both at-home and salon/doctor's office use.

One of the first pieces of equipment you should understand is a tool which measures the precise coloring of your skin and hair colors, so that the clinician can know the precise type of equipment and equipment setting which will best suit you individually.

In addition there being numerous different models and types of laser equipment which are commonly used today, it should be noted that each of these devices is highly customizable based on the attributes of the individual receiving the treatment.

 One adjustable characteristic of laser equipment is that there are varying wavelengths of laser lights used in treating different individuals. Wavelengths are measured in nanometers. There are three different wavelengths which are commonly used today: Alexandrite, which is at 755 nanometers, Pulsed Diode Array, which is at 810 nm, and Nd: YAG, at 1064 nm. While Alexandrite is considered the most effective wavelength, it can only be used on individuals with light-colored skin; Nd: YAG is most commonly used for individuals with darker skin.

Another aspect of laser equipment that is adjustable is the pulse-width of the laser beam. Individuals with darker skin tone often are treated with longer pulse-widths, although it is believed that shorter pulse-widths are more effective in treating hair.

Other aspects of laser equipment which are adjustable include the width of the laser beam, the energy level used, and the repetition rate of laser pulses. The proper settings for each of these parameters will be determined by the facets of the individual receiving the treatment. The technician or clinician performing the laser hair removal procedure will select the proper equipment and settings for each client.
